Ses derniers messages sur les forums
Bonjour,
Je fais actuellement un site pseudo marchand (sans paiement sécurisé) et je rencontre un souci avec les sessions
En effet, sur toute les pages je met mon script de session avec insertion dans la bdd de l'id de session représentée par time ().
Mon souci, est que sur chaque page il me met une nouvelle id session.
J'espère que je suis clair.
Voilà mon script sur chaque page
<?php
//script de connexion bdd
include ("commun/connec.inc.php");
$now=time();
session_start();
if ( $_session['client'] == "" )
{
$sql="INSERT INTO session_client (id_session) values ('$now');";
$req=mysql_query ($sql) or die (mysql_error());
session_start();
$_SESSION['client']=$now;
}
?>
Bonjour,
J'ai un petit souci sur un iframe,
je voudrais savoir comment passer une variable de la page parente vers la iframe, sachant que ce lien recharge la page parente (changement de langue).
Le contenu le iframe change aussi par cette variable envoyé via le lien.
J'espère etre compréhensible et que vous pourrez m'aider
merci
je comprend très bien ta fonction mais tu n'as pas oublié de déclaré la valeur de $lg_max?
Je suppose qu'avant tout tu met
$lg_max=20 ;
Sinon je vois pas comment ça ça peut marcher puisque ta condition du if ne peut etre vérifiée.....
Dis moi si je me trompe.
D'autre part la tu met $chaine="zae......", est il possible de mettre une variable résultant d'une requete sql tel un $texte par exemple?
Oups j'ai fais une bourde, bon voilà mon problème
Bonjour,
Je souhaite afficher des news dans une partie de la page, mais en affichant que le début de la news (100 premiers caractères) avec un lien vers la news complète, hors ça marche pour le premier enregistrement, mais la suivante n'affiche que le LIRE LA SUITE. Je ne trouve pas mon erreur, pouvez vous me donner un coup de main?
<?php
$sql="select * from news order by ID_NEWS desc limit 2";
$result=mysql_query($sql);
while ($val=mysql_fetch_array($result))
{
$titre=$val["TITRE"];
$texte=$val["TEXTE"];
$photo=$val["IMAGE"];
$id=$val["ID_NEWS"];
$date=date("j / m / Y ",$val['DATE']);
$maxcara=100;
if (strlen ($texte)>$maxcara)
{
$texte=substr($texte, 0, $maxcara);
$textesp=strrpos ($texte, " ");
$texte=substr($texte, 0 , $textesp);
$suite="<a href=\"news.php?ID=".$id."\"target=\"_self\" class='news'>... Lire la suite</a>";
}
else
{
$suite="<a href=\"news.php?ID=".$id."\"target=\"_self\" class='news'>... Lire la suite</a>";
}
?>
<p align="left" class="news"><img src="images/puce_12.jpg" width="17" height="14"><?=$titre?><br>
<?=$texte ?><?=$suite ?>
</p>
<?php }
?>
Bonjour,
j'ai un petit souci de mise en page avec mes css.
Qd la page est en html simple, les styles s'appliquent très bien mais j'ai mis du PHP pour la mise à jour de certaines données et la les styles ne marchent plus....
J'ai essayé de mettre des <div> ou <span> avec des styles affiliés mais rien n'y fais...
Pourriez vous me toruver une solution? Merci
je sais, g modifier ça, c'était jsute pour l'emplacement des requetes
merci en tout cas, g un petit soucis de récupération de variable mais à prioris ça marche donc,
merci beaucoup
Si j'ai bien compris dans mon traitement du formulaire, cela donne
<?php
if (isset($_POST['go']) && $_POST['go']=='Modifier') {
// modifier
$sql=requete pour modifier
}
elseif (isset($_POST['go']) && $_POST['go']=='Supprimer') {
// supprimer
$sql1=requete pour supprimer
}
else {
// problème
}
?>
Merci de ta réponse mais je vais réexpliquer,
le bouton modifier va bien vers ma page de traitement, en revanche comment puis je assigner un traitement à supprimer puisqu'il n'ya qu'une action par formulaire?
Je ne vois pas de quoi tu parle, les variablemodif_gam et supp_gam, ne sont pas des variables mais des nom de champs.....
Bonsoir, j'ai un petit souci en php....
J'ai une liste à choix qui prend ses ressources ds la BDD à coté de cela, j'ai un bouton modifier qui pointe vers un modifier.php et un supprimer qui ne pointe vers rien puisque les deux sont dans le même formulaire...., comment faire en sorte que ce bouton pointe vers un supprimer?php?
voici le code avec un peu de javascript
<?
function getID(){
modifier_gamme.modif_id.value = modifier_gamme.gamme.options[modifier_gamme.gamme.selectedIndex].value;
//return alert("id" + modifier_gamme.modif_id.value);
}
function Delete (){
alert ("voulez vous supprimer " + modifier_gamme.gamme.options[modifier_gamme.gamme.selectedIndex].text);
modifier_gamme.action= "index.php";
}
$sql="select * from gamme order by Nom_gamme";
$result=mysql_query($sql);
echo ('<form action="modifier_gamme.php" method="post" name="modifier_gamme" id="modifier_gamme">');
echo('<select name="gamme">');
while ($val=mysql_fetch_array($result))
{
$ID=$val['ID_gamme'];
$Nom_gamme=$val['Nom_gamme'];
echo('<option value='.$ID.'>'.$Nom_gamme.'</option>');
}
echo('</select>');
echo ('<input type="hidden" name="modif_id" value="">');
echo ('<input type="submit" name="modif_gam" value="Modifier" onClick="getID()">');
echo ('<input type="submit" name="supp_gam" value="Supprimer" onClick="getID();Delete()">');
echo ('</form>');
?>